Engaging Your Lender Promptly
When monetary challenges lead to delays in your mortgage payments, the most effective initial action is to reach out to your lender right away. Early contact can help open the door to options like forbearance agreements, repayment plans, or even a loan modification. Having clear, organized information on hand—like recent pay stubs, bank statements, and a summary of your expenses—can make the conversation more productive. Taking this straightforward measure can pave the way for collaborative problem-solving tailored to your needs.
Initiating a conversation about your options demonstrates to your lender that you are committed to protecting your home.
In a conversation, you might inquire about temporary relief programs or inquire whether there's a way to reduce your monthly payments.
Lenders often have unique programs to assist homeowners in Hamilton Township, NJ, as well as in nearby places such as Ewing or Trenton.
This approach fosters trust and demonstrates your commitment to overcoming short-term financial challenges.
Here are a few simple tips before contacting your lender:
- Collect your financial documents
- Write down important questions regarding repayment options
- Clarify the changes in your income or expenses in detail
Using these straightforward steps and clear communication boosts your chances of finding a workable solution to avoid foreclosure in New Jersey.
Exploring Local Assistance Programs and Mediation
Hamilton Township presents several local programs designed for homeowners who are at risk of Go Here foreclosure.
These programs frequently feature mediation sessions where a neutral party helps both sides come to a mutual agreement.
Homeowners in nearby cities like Cherry Hill, Mount Holly, or Willingboro can also access similar help through their local nonprofit agencies.
The mediation service in New Jersey is designed to bring homeowners and lenders together. Via mediation, you get an opportunity to secure better payment terms or explore potential alternatives that might not have been apparent initially.
Accessing these services is usually simple—you can begin by contacting local housing agencies or a nonprofit offering legal support. Numerous community advocates and financial counselors in regions like Bordentown and Burlington are known for guiding residents through these options.
If you're thinking about mediation, consider these steps:
- Contact local nonprofit organizations or legal support organizations.
- Inquire about government-supported mediation programs.
- Prepare a list of your financial details and questions.
By taking these steps, you not only enhance your position but also clear the way to prevent foreclosure in New Jersey.

Evaluating Options Such as Refinancing or Selling
Sometimes, even with hard work, refinancing or selling your home could prove most beneficial.
Refinancing may reduce your interest rate and adjust your payment schedule, making it easier to manage your monthly mortgage.
However, keep in mind that refinancing might incur fees and could extend your loan period.
It's wise to look into various lenders and compare their offers before reaching a conclusion.
For those living in Hamilton Township and nearby regions like Princeton or Willingboro, selling the property before foreclosure takes hold could serve as a practical option.
This might not be an easy decision, it may help maintain your credit score and enable you to tap into any home equity available.
Working with a local real estate agent who understands the market in areas like Burlington or Ewing can be helpful. They offer advice on optimal listing times and strategies to secure the best possible deal.
When considering these alternatives, think about the following:
- Compare the costs of refinancing with the potential benefits.
- Determine if selling your home might prevent an extended foreclosure procedure.
- Consult financial advisors and local real estate professionals for impartial guidance.
By weighing your options carefully, you can choose the path that best supports your financial health while helping you avoid foreclosure in New Jersey.
